48 Joffre St, Mowbray is a 4 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1942. The property has a land size of 809m2 and floor size of 129m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in August 2023.

The size of Mowbray is approximately 9.4 square kilometres. It has 12 parks covering nearly 15.5% of total area. The population of Mowbray in 2016 was 3733 people. By 2021 the population was 4048 showing a population growth of 8.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mowbray is 20-29 years. Households in Mowbray are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mowbray work in a community and personal service occupation.In 2021, 46.10% of the homes in Mowbray were owner-occupied compared with 47.90% in 2016.
